    Vector potential and inductances for stationary current distributions with rotational symmetry are considered. The approach is in terms of those hypergeometric functions that yield the simplest expressions, rather than (traditionally) the two complete elliptic integrals. For instance, the vector potential itself is an integral involving \(_ 2F_ 1[{3 \over 2},{3 \over 2};3;x]\), while the self-inductance of a flat circular coil with inner radius \(a\) and outer radius \(b\) is expressed in terms of \(_ 3F_ 2[(a/b)^ 2]\), \(_ 4F_ 3[(a/b)^ 2]\) and Catalan's constant.
